About The Position

This position is responsible for training and supporting Class A Commercial Driver’s License (CDLA) drivers. Training and development will include new hire on-boarding, annual recurring, behavior-based, and remedial post event. Driver Support Trainers will be available to assist drivers with any day-to-day situations they may encounter.

Requirements

  • Able to perform all necessary safety functions while performing training and instructing including working in an outdoor environment. Including but not limited to: Consistently able to use three points of contact when entering and exiting equipment during training sessions. Capable of conducting a comprehensive DOT inspection of both truck and trailer, including the ability to navigate beneath the trailer to verify the equipment's proper functioning. Moving training supplies such as placement of traffic cones, barrels, barriers, etc. Standing for extended periods while conducting hands-on training and road testing.
  • Ability to access and manage data through spreadsheets and dashboards.
  • Working knowledge of Federal Motor Carrier Safety Regulation Part 395.
  • One year of experience in the transportation field.
  • CDL-A Driving experience required.

Responsibilities

  • Must be familiar with Department of Transportation regulations with a specific focus on Hours of Service, Driver Qualifications, Electronic Logging Device, Navigation, Permits, and Vehicle Inspections.
  • Ability to train CDL drivers with various levels of experience.
  • Deliver instruction both in a classroom and one on one settings through practical, hands-on training.
  • Strong verbal and written communication abilities to effectively engage with drivers, operators, and management.
  • Customer service-oriented approach, assisting drivers and managers through phone support, e-mail, or personal interactions.
  • Conduct onsite training sessions with drivers at field locations.
